Born on June 8, 1958, in New York City, Keenen Ivory Wayans grew up in a large family with a rich history of artistic talent. His siblings, including Damon Wayans and Marlon Wayans, also ventured into the entertainment world, creating a legacy that reflects their collective comedic prowess. Throughout his career, Keenen Ivory Wayans has been a dynamic figure, known for his wit and innovative approach to humor. He gained widespread recognition with the hit television series "In Living Color," which not only entertained audiences but also addressed important social issues through satire. This groundbreaking show opened doors for many comedians and actors, making Keenen a significant force in the comedy landscape. Keenen Ivory Wayans has had a profound impact on the comedy world and has influenced countless comedians. His work in "In Living Color" allowed for a broader representation of African American voices in comedy, paving the way for artists like Dave Chappelle, Tiffany Haddish, and many others. The show's success demonstrated that comedy could be both entertaining and socially relevant, encouraging future comedians to address serious topics through humor.

Keenen's pioneering spirit is evident in his approach to television. He was one of the first African Americans to create and star in a successful sketch comedy show, which broke down racial barriers in the industry. His innovative format and willingness to tackle controversial subjects have inspired numerous television programs that followed.
